Como resolver jQuery que quebra após atualização no WordPress

Introdução

O jQuery é uma biblioteca de JavaScript amplamente utilizada para simplificar a interação com elementos HTML, manipulação de eventos e animações em páginas da web. No entanto, muitos desenvolvedores enfrentam problemas após atualizarem o WordPress, onde o jQuery pode quebrar e causar erros no funcionamento do site. Neste glossário, vamos abordar como resolver esses problemas de forma eficiente e garantir que o jQuery funcione corretamente após a atualização do WordPress.

Verificando a Versão do jQuery

Antes de mais nada, é importante verificar qual versão do jQuery está sendo utilizada no seu site WordPress. Isso pode ser feito acessando o código-fonte da página e procurando pela referência ao arquivo do jQuery. Caso esteja desatualizado, é recomendável atualizá-lo para a versão mais recente para garantir compatibilidade com as últimas atualizações do WordPress.

Verificando Conflitos de Plugins

Um dos principais motivos para o jQuery quebrar após uma atualização do WordPress são os conflitos de plugins. Muitas vezes, plugins desatualizados ou incompatíveis podem interferir no funcionamento do jQuery e causar erros. Para resolver esse problema, é importante desativar todos os plugins do seu site e ativá-los um por um, verificando se o jQuery funciona corretamente após cada ativação.

Verificando Conflitos de Temas

Além dos plugins, os temas também podem causar conflitos com o jQuery após uma atualização do WordPress. Temas desatualizados ou mal otimizados podem interferir na execução do jQuery e gerar erros. Para resolver esse problema, recomenda-se alterar temporariamente para um tema padrão do WordPress, como o Twenty Twenty-One, e verificar se o jQuery funciona corretamente. Se sim, o problema está no tema atual e será necessário atualizá-lo ou procurar por um tema mais compatível.

Atualizando o jQuery Manualmente

Caso nenhum dos métodos acima resolva o problema, é possível atualizar o jQuery manualmente no seu site WordPress. Para isso, basta baixar a versão mais recente do jQuery no site oficial e substituir o arquivo antigo no diretório do seu tema. Certifique-se de fazer um backup do arquivo original antes de fazer qualquer alteração e teste o site para garantir que o jQuery está funcionando corretamente.

Utilizando o jQuery no Modo NoConflict

Outra maneira de resolver problemas de compatibilidade do jQuery no WordPress é utilizando o modo NoConflict. Esse modo permite que o jQuery coexista com outras bibliotecas JavaScript que também utilizam o símbolo “$”. Para ativar o modo NoConflict, basta adicionar o seguinte código ao arquivo functions.php do seu tema:

“`php
wp_deregister_script(‘jquery’);
wp_register_script(‘jquery’, ‘https://ajax.googleapis.com/ajax/libs/jquery/3.6.0/jquery.min.js’, false, ‘3.6.0’);
wp_enqueue_script(‘jquery’);
“`

Verificando Erros no Console do Navegador

Uma maneira eficiente de identificar problemas com o jQuery é verificando os erros no console do navegador. Para acessar o console, basta clicar com o botão direito do mouse na página, selecionar a opção “Inspecionar” e ir para a aba “Console”. Lá, você poderá ver mensagens de erro relacionadas ao jQuery e identificar possíveis causas do problema.

Utilizando Plugins de Depuração

Existem diversos plugins de depuração disponíveis para WordPress que podem ajudar a identificar e resolver problemas com o jQuery. Alguns dos mais populares incluem o Query Monitor, Debug Bar e P3 (Plugin Performance Profiler). Esses plugins fornecem informações detalhadas sobre o desempenho do seu site e possíveis erros de jQuery que podem estar ocorrendo.

Verificando a Ordem de Carregamento dos Scripts

A ordem de carregamento dos scripts no WordPress pode afetar o funcionamento do jQuery. Certifique-se de que o jQuery está sendo carregado antes de qualquer outro script que dependa dele. Para isso, verifique o arquivo functions.php do seu tema e garanta que o jQuery seja enfileirado corretamente utilizando a função wp_enqueue_script.

Testando em Ambientes de Desenvolvimento

Para evitar problemas com o jQuery após atualizações do WordPress, é recomendável testar todas as alterações em um ambiente de desenvolvimento antes de aplicá-las ao site ao vivo. Isso permite identificar possíveis erros e corrigi-los sem impactar a experiência dos usuários. Utilize ferramentas como o XAMPP, WampServer ou MAMP para criar um ambiente local e realizar testes com segurança.

Consultando a Comunidade WordPress

Caso ainda tenha dificuldades em resolver problemas com o jQuery no WordPress, não hesite em consultar a comunidade WordPress. Fóruns, grupos de discussão e sites especializados podem fornecer suporte e orientações para solucionar questões técnicas. Compartilhe seu problema e busque por soluções recomendadas por outros desenvolvedores experientes.

Conclusão

Em resumo, resolver problemas com o jQuery que quebra após atualização no WordPress requer paciência, conhecimento técnico e prática. Ao seguir as dicas e técnicas apresentadas neste glossário, você estará mais preparado para identificar e corrigir erros relacionados ao jQuery e garantir o bom funcionamento do seu site WordPress. Lembre-se de sempre fazer backups regulares do seu site e testar todas as alterações antes de aplicá-las ao ambiente de produção. Com dedicação e perseverança, você conseguirá superar qualquer desafio relacionado ao jQuery no WordPress.

Compartilhe este artigo:

Share on facebook
Share on linkedin
Share on telegram
Share on whatsapp

Artigos Recentes

Links importantes

Contatos